Sinusitis - Causes, Indicators and Treatment

by Adonia Abendroth

Sinus inflammation or swelling is one of the most typical problems from the respiratory system. This could also be thought as inflammation of the lining of mucus membrane from the sinuses hard. Sinuses are hollow cavities with mucus membrane lining and are positioned in bones with the face across the nose. Also, sinusitis is classed into different categories. If sinusitis persists for a few days then it is named as acute sinusitis however, if it persists for couple weeks then it is called chronic sinusitis, and this can be tough to identify.

The signs of sinusitis- It is quite a debilitating condition which affects the entire body. Some common signs of sinusitis are-

* Nasal congestion with thick nasal discharge

* Pain and pressure behind and round the eyes, nose and forehead

* Severe headache each day which frequently subsides from the afternoon

* Cough

* Fever

* General fatigue

Reasons for sinusitis

Sinusitis is due to the viruses which trigger colds. When viral infection causes swelling with the sinuses, it leads to blocking from the nasal openings that hinders the flow of mucus and air. Consequently, bacteria grow in the sinuses and cause sinus infection. Also, sinusitis can be allergic, bacterial, fungal or viral.
